Criteria for allocating free broadcast time
Question: What are the criteria for allocating free broadcast time and/or free printed advertisement space to political parties?
Answer(s):
a . Equal regardless of size of party and previous performance
Comments:
Political parties which have gone through state registration shall have the right to use the state media on equal conditions.
Source:
Law of Turkmenistan on Political Parties (2012), art. 23 (7), 29 (1)

Television debates
Question: Are televised debates between candidates or party representatives normally conducted?
Answer(s):
c . No
Comments:
No information about the organization of televised debates is available in the observation mission reports of the OSCE/ODIHR.

Blackout period for release of opinion poll results.
Question: What is the blackout period, if any, during which results of pre-election opinion polls may not be released to the public?
Answer:
h . Not applicable
Comments:
The Law doesn't specify any blackout period.
Source:
Law on Elections of the President of Turkmenistan (2011);
Law of Turkmenistan on Elections of Deputies of the Mejlis of Turkmenistan (2008)

Question: Is there a maximum amount that a political party is permitted to spend on paid advertising during a campaign period?
Answer:
b . No
Comments:
The Law does not contain any provisions on paid advertising.
Source:
Law of Turkmenistan on Political Parties (2012);
Law of Turkmenistan on Elections of Deputies of the Mejlis of Turkmenistan (2008), art. 38
